什么是CAD编程?_这种技术广泛应用于工程设计_CAD编程需要哪些技术能力
什么是CAD编程?
CAD编程指的是使用计算机辅助设计软件来编写程序或执行设计任务。这种技术广泛应用于工程设计、建筑、制造等领域。CAD编程需要哪些硬件配置?
为了确保CAD编程的高效和顺畅,以下是一些关键硬件配置:- 处理器(CPU):选择一个高性能的多核处理器,以应对复杂的计算任务和数据处理。
- 内存(RAM):至少需要16GB的RAM,对于更高级或大型项目,可能需要更多。
- 图形处理卡(GPU):专业图形处理卡,特别是拥有大量显存和高性能的GPU,对于三维建模和渲染至关重要。
- 存储设备:使用固态硬盘(SSD)以提供更快的读写速度。
- 显示屏:高分辨率和大尺寸的显示器,以获得清晰的视觉体验和更宽敞的工作空间。
CAD编程需要的软件配置是怎样的?
以下是一些必要的软件配置:- CAD软件:如AutoCAD、SolidWorks等,提供编程接口和工具。
- 开发环境:如Visual Studio或PyCharm,提供开发所需的工具和调试支持。
- 版本管理工具:如Git,用于跟踪代码变化和团队协作。
CAD编程需要哪些技术能力?
以下是一些关键的技术能力:- 编程能力:至少了解一种编程语言,如C++、C或Python。
- CAD软件知识:熟悉所选CAD软件的基本操作和绘图原理。
- 数学和几何知识:理解几何图形和数学概念,对于CAD编程至关重要。
- 算法和数据结构:了解算法和数据结构,以优化性能和实现复杂的CAD功能。
硬件配置详解
下面我们详细看一下CAD编程所需的硬件配置:处理器(CPU)
CAD软件在设计和建模过程中会执行复杂的计算和数据处理,因此一个强大的CPU对于快速和高效的作业至关重要。性能较高的处理器可以显著减少渲染时间,提升工作效率。
内存(RAM)
CAD应用程序通常需要大量内存来顺利运行。足够的RAM可以确保软件运行时的响应速度,即使是在处理大型文件时。内存不足可能导致系统变慢或者程序崩溃,因此,至少16GB的RAM是推荐的起点。
图形处理卡(GPU)
专业的图形处理卡是实现流畅视觉效果和高效渲染的关键硬件。专用的图形卡比集成图形解决方案提供更好的性能,特别是在处理三维建模和高分辨率渲染时。
存储设备(HDD/SSD)
固态硬盘(SSD)由于其较快的数据访问速度,是CAD设计师的首选。SSD减少了项目加载和保存的时间,同时也支持快速执行软件的启动和运行。
显示屏(Monitor)
质量高的显示屏对于CAD设计是非常必要的,因为它们提供了更好的视觉体验和更精确的细节展示。高分辨率的监视器可以提供更细致的图像,而大屏幕则可以提供更宽广的工作空间。
兼容性和升级空间
在搭建或购买CAD工作站时,不仅要考虑上述硬件配置,还应该考虑未来可能的升级空间。选择一个好的主板和充足的扩展插槽是很有必要的。系统的散热性能也不容忽视,因为高效的散热系统可以保证长时间的稳定运行。
为了获取最佳的CAD体验和最高的工作效率,投资于高性能的硬件和合适的配置是非常必要的。虽然这可能意味着较高的起始成本,但高效率和长期稳定的性能将带来更优的长期价值。